Using a public network without a robust VPN is akin to broadcasting your personal information to anyone with the right AI tools.Key Features to Look for in a 2026 VPN Against AI Threats
When selecting a VPN to combat AI hackers in 2026, you need to look beyond basic encryption. First, prioritize VPNs that offer **post-quantum cryptography (PQC) readiness** or at least demonstrably future-proof encryption standards that are resistant to potential quantum computing attacks. Second, **AI-driven threat detection and blocking** within the VPN client itself can provide an additional layer of defense, identifying and neutralizing suspicious connections or malicious traffic patterns before they reach your device. A strict, independently audited **no-logs policy** is non-negotiable, ensuring no metadata or activity logs can ever be compromised. Look for features like **multi-hop (double VPN)** connections for layered encryption, **obfuscated servers** to disguise VPN usage from sophisticated AI traffic analysis, and **advanced kill switches** that prevent any data leakage if the VPN connection drops. Finally, a robust **global server network** with high-speed infrastructure is vital for maintaining performance while ensuring security.
